Sanjay Chauhan (1962 – 12 January 2023) was an Indian screenwriter in Hindi cinema, most known for I Am Kalam (2011) for which he won the Filmfare Award for Best Story., [1] and Paan Singh Tomar (2012), which he co-wrote with Tigmanshu Dhulia [2] Biography.

Sanjay Chauhan is an Indian screenplay writer and actor, born in 1962 in Bhopal, Madhya Pradesh. He contributed to several films including Paan Singh Tomar, I Am Kalam and Saheb Biwi Aur Gangster. He was also associated with television series, Bhanwar.
